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Lyon to Aix is to drive which costs €35 - €55 and takes 2h 44m.
The fastest way to get from Lyon to Aix is to drive which takes 2h 44m and costs €35 - €55.
The distance between Lyon and Aix is 289 km. The road distance is 229.6 km.
The best way to get from Lyon to Aix without a car is to train and taxi which takes 3h 29m and costs €180 - €260.
It takes approximately 3h 29m to get from Lyon to Aix, including transfers.
Yes, the driving distance between Lyon to Aix is 230 km. It takes approximately 2h 44m to drive from Lyon to Aix.

What companies run services between Lyon, France and Aix, Nouvelle-Aquitaine, France?
FlixBus operates a bus from Lyon to Ussel twice daily. Tickets cost €17–29 and the journey takes 3h 30m. BlaBlaCar Bus also services this route once a week.
